About WorkPac

WorkPac kicked off back in 1997 as Australia’s biggest homegrown outfit for hooking up jobs in tough spots like mines and builds, now stretching across the country with a million-plus folks on the books. From Brisbane’s HQ, it feeds talent into everything from heavy gear ops to health gigs, always chasing that safe, smart fit. The whole “Good Move” tagline? It’s no fluff—it’s about landing roles that stick and grow, without the drama. They’ve rolled out their third Reconciliation Action Plan to pull in more Indigenous talent, making sites feel like real community hubs.
